Mass spectrometry is a powerful analytical tool that enables scientists to identify and quantify molecules with remarkable precision. At the heart of MS lies the ionization process. Understanding the different ionization methods in mass spectrometry enables selection of the most appropriate technique to accurately analyze your data.

Mass spectrometry (MS) is a valuable tool that can give you vast amounts of MS data to help you identify and quantify components. MS has been used to discover, determine, and quantify sample compounds in the proteomics, metabolomics, imaging, and glycomics applications across the food, pharmaceutical, and environmental industries. Combining MS with appropriate software and computer technology allows the possibility for more extensive applications. But first, we must understand the basics.
